Tulkarem pullout expected

Tuesday, March 08, 2005 |    

Israeli defense minister Shaul Mofaz will meet today with Palestinian Prime Minister Mahmoud Abbas, and they’re expected to announce an Israeli pullout from the town of Tulkarem in Samaria. Some 2,500 Palestinian police will deploy in the town with a pledge to prevent terrorist attacks against Israelis. Israeli army chief of staff Lieutenant-General Moshe Ya'alon said it’s up to the Palestinians to end gang rule and restore law and order. Tulkarem is a test case--if it's quiet there, Israel will withdraw from four more towns in Judea and Samaria.
